基于CloudFoundry平台开发JAVA应用指南
3星 · 超过75%的资源 需积分: 9 106 浏览量
更新于2024-07-26
收藏 2.92MB DOCX 举报
Cloud Foundry 上开发 JAVA 应用
Cloud Foundry 是一个开源的 PaaS 云计算平台,它提供给开发者自由度去选择云平台,开发框架和应用服务。Cloud Foundry 最初由 VMware 发起,得到了业界广泛的支持,它使得开发者能够更快更容易地开发、测试、部署和扩展应用。
**Cloud Foundry 的特点**
Cloud Foundry 是一个开源项目,用户可以使用多种私有云发行版,也可以使用公共云服务,包括 CloudFoundry.com。Cloud Foundry 提供了多种语言支持,包括 Java、Python、Ruby、PHP 等,使得开发者可以轻松地部署和扩展应用。
**MicroCloudFoundry**
MicroCloudFoundry 是 Cloud Foundry 的完整实例,运行在开发人员的 Mac 或 PC 上的虚拟机中。它提供了本地部署的灵活性,同时又为您提供将来部署和扩展应用程序的选择。MicroCloudFoundry 是一个可下载的虚拟机映像,与用于 MacOSX 的 VMware Fusion 及用于 Linux 和 Windows 的 VMware Workstation 和 VMware Player(可免费下载)兼容。
**Cloud Foundry 的架构**
Cloud Foundry 的架构主要由三个部分组成:Router、 DEA( Droplet Execution Agent)和 HM9000(Health Manager)。Router 负责接收和路由用户请求,DEA 负责管理和执行应用程序,HM9000 负责监控和管理应用程序的健康状况。
**Cloud Foundry 的优点**
Cloud Foundry 提供了多种语言支持、灵活的部署方式和强大的扩展能力,使得开发者能够快速开发、测试和部署应用程序。Cloud Foundry 的开放式架构使得开发者可以轻松地集成第三方服务和工具。
**Cloud Foundry 的应用场景**
Cloud Foundry 可以应用于多种场景,包括 web 应用程序、移动应用程序、游戏开发等。Cloud Foundry 的灵活性和扩展能力使得它非常适合大型企业和中小型企业的应用开发。
**Cloud Foundry 的资源**
Cloud Foundry 提供了多种资源,包括官方网站、博客、Twitter、Facebook 等。开发者可以通过这些资源来获取 Cloud Foundry 的最新信息和技术支持。
**Cloud Foundry 的中文资源**
Cloud Foundry 的中文资源包括中文网站、中文博客、微博等。开发者可以通过这些资源来获取 Cloud Foundry 的中文信息和技术支持。
**Cloud Foundry 的在线资源**
Cloud Foundry 的在线资源包括产品介绍 PPT、视频等。开发者可以通过这些资源来获取 Cloud Foundry 的详细信息和技术支持。
**Cloud Foundry 的开发指南**
Cloud Foundry 提供了详细的开发指南,包括 Cloud Foundry 的安装、配置、部署和扩展等。开发者可以通过这些资源来快速学习和掌握 Cloud Foundry 的开发。
**Cloud Foundry 和 JAVA 应用**
Cloud Foundry 提供了多种语言支持,包括 Java。开发者可以使用 Java 语言来开发 Cloud Foundry 应用程序。Cloud Foundry 为 Java 应用程序提供了多种支持,包括 Spring、 Hibernate 等。
**Cloud Foundry 的未来发展**
Cloud Foundry 的未来发展方向是继续扩展和完善其功能,包括支持更多的语言和框架,提高其扩展能力和灵活性等。Cloud Foundry 的开放式架构和强大的社区支持使得它有很大的发展潜力。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2022-05-09 上传
2021-10-01 上传
2022-09-20 上传
2021-10-15 上传
2023-10-09 上传
2021-05-03 上传
chenyong198500
- 粉丝: 0
- 资源: 5
最新资源
- C语言数组操作:高度检查器编程实践
- 基于Swift开发的嘉定单车LBS iOS应用项目解析
- 钗头凤声乐表演的二度创作分析报告
- 分布式数据库特训营全套教程资料
- JavaScript开发者Robert Bindar的博客平台
- MATLAB投影寻踪代码教程及文件解压缩指南
- HTML5拖放实现的RPSLS游戏教程
- HT://Dig引擎接口,Ampoliros开源模块应用
- 全面探测服务器性能与PHP环境的iprober PHP探针v0.024
- 新版提醒应用v2:基于MongoDB的数据存储
- 《我的世界》东方大陆1.12.2材质包深度体验
- Hypercore Promisifier: JavaScript中的回调转换为Promise包装器
- 探索开源项目Artifice:Slyme脚本与技巧游戏
- Matlab机器人学习代码解析与笔记分享
- 查尔默斯大学计算物理作业HP2解析
- GitHub问题管理新工具:GIRA-crx插件介绍